Los asistentes de programación con IA son potentes, pero tienen limitaciones: los datos de entrenamiento se cortan en una fecha específica y faltan funciones y cambios nuevos de la API. Sin acceso a la documentación específica de Gemini, los agentes pueden sugerir patrones genéricos en lugar de enfoques optimizados.
La habilidad de desarrollo de la API de Gemini aborda estas brechas brindándole a tu agente de codificación acceso directo a la documentación, los patrones de integración y las prácticas recomendadas más recientes de la API de Gemini. Esto garantiza que tu agente pueda ofrecer ejemplos de código y orientación más precisos y específicos. Aprovechando esta habilidad, tu asistente de programación se mantiene al día con la API de Gemini en constante evolución y su uso recomendado.
Qué proporciona la skill
La habilidad de desarrollo de la API de Gemini (gemini-api-dev):
- Dirige tu agente de programación a la documentación oficial de la API de Gemini
- Proporciona prácticas recomendadas para compilar aplicaciones potenciadas por Gemini
- Incluye patrones recomendados para integraciones comunes
En las siguientes secciones, se describen los métodos de instalación según el ecosistema de administración de habilidades que prefieras. Ambos instalan la misma habilidad. Ejecuta estos comandos en tu terminal desde cualquier directorio.
- skills.sh: Se recomienda. Es el estándar abierto para los comportamientos portátiles de los agentes.
- Context7: Se admite para los usuarios que ya utilizan el ecosistema de Context7.
Instalación con skills.sh
# List available skills
npx skills add google-gemini/gemini-skills --list
# Install the gemini-api-dev skill globally
npx skills add google-gemini/gemini-skills --skill gemini-api-dev --global
Instalación con Context7
# Interactively browse and install skills
npx ctx7 skills install /google-gemini/gemini-skills
# Install a specific skill directly
npx ctx7 skills install /google-gemini/gemini-skills gemini-api-dev
Verifica la instalación
Después de la instalación, confirma que tu agente de codificación haya indexado la habilidad y pueda acceder a la documentación activa de la API de Gemini.
1. Verifica el comportamiento del agente
La forma más confiable de verificarlo es hacerle a tu agente una pregunta técnica sobre la API de Gemini.
Instrucción: "¿Cómo uso el almacenamiento de contexto en caché con la API de Gemini?"
Si la instalación se realiza correctamente, sucederá lo siguiente:
- Haz referencia a métodos específicos de Gemini, como
cacheContentocachedContents.create. - Mostrar un indicador que diga "Using skill: gemini-api-dev".
Verifica el manifiesto
Si el agente da una respuesta genérica, usa el comando específico de "descubrimiento" para tu entorno y verifica que la skill se haya cargado.
| Entorno | Método de verificación |
|---|---|
| Claude Code | Escribe /skills en la terminal para enumerar todos los manifiestos activos. |
| Cursor | Abre Configuración > Reglas. Verifica que aparezca gemini-api-dev en "El agente decide". |
| Antigravity | Escribe /skills list o consulta la barra lateral Personalizaciones > Reglas. |
| Gemini CLI | Ejecuta gemini skills list o usa el comando de barra /skills durante la sesión. |
| Copiloto | Escribe @gemini /skills (o solo /skills) para ver las extensiones activas. |
Solución de problemas
Si tu agente solo proporciona información general o no reconoce los métodos específicos de Gemini, verifica lo siguiente:
El agente no descubrió la skill
La mayoría de los agentes indexan las habilidades solo al inicio.
Corrección: Reinicia por completo tu IDE (Cursor/VS Code) o sal y vuelve a abrir tu agente basado en terminal (Claude Code).
Conflictos globales y locales
Si realizaste la instalación con la marca --global, es posible que el agente la ignore en favor de las reglas específicas del proyecto.
Solución: Intenta instalar la habilidad directamente en la raíz de tu proyecto sin la marca global:
npx skills add google-gemini/gemini-skills --skill gemini-api-dev